Report Overview:

M2M (Machine-to-Machine) refers to the flow of data between physical objects, without the need for human interaction. M2M connectivity has opened a multi-billion dollar revenue opportunity for mobile operators, MVNOs and service aggregators, addressing the application needs of several verticals markets. By enabling network connectivity among physical objects, M2M has also initiated the IoT (Internet of Things) vision - a global network of sensors, equipment, appliances, smart devices and applications that can communicate in real time.

SNS Research estimates that global spending on M2M and IoT technologies will reach nearly $250 Billion by 2020, driven by a host of vertical market applications including but not limited to connected car services, remote asset tracking, healthcare monitoring, smart metering, digital signage, home automation and intelligent buildings.

Key Findings:
The report has the following key findings:
  • SNS Research estimates that global spending on M2M and IoT technologies will reach nearly $250 Billion by 2020, driven by a host of vertical market applications including but not limited to connected car services, remote asset tracking, healthcare monitoring, smart metering, digital signage, home automation and intelligent buildings
  • The installed base of M2M connections will grow at a CAGR of nearly 30% between 2015 and 2020, eventually accounting for over 10 Billion connections worldwide
  • SNS Research estimates that multimedia and video applications will account for more than 20% of the revenue generated by M2M and IoT services by 2020, amid growing incorporation of LTE in M2M modules and gateways
  • Besides optimizing their cellular networks for M2M services, mobile operators are increasingly investing in LPWA (Low Power Wide Area) networks for low power, low bandwidth IoT applications
